How many protons electrons does sodium have?

The atomic number of sodium is 11 which means it has 11 protons and 11 electrons.


How many protons on the third shell of a sodium atom?

The protons are in the nucleus. It's the electrons that are in the "shells" around the nucleus. There's just one electron in the third shell of the sodium atom.

How many electrons does a neutral atom of sodium-25 have?

A neutral atom of sodium has 11 electrons. Sodium-25 refers to the isotope of sodium with 25 total protons and neutrons, so a neutral sodium-25 atom would still have 11 electrons to balance the 11 protons in the nucleus.
